    City Golf is a great experience for beginners and pros and everything in between whether you're…read morewanting to dodge the sun, the rain or just wanting to hone in on your skills. I took my husband there for his birthday and selected a bay for two people. This was our first time so we didn't really know what to expect. We picked a virtual course in Korea which was on the tougher side but still had a good time. The bay was semi private which was exactly what we wanted. The ball sets up automatically and upon each swing, it rolls down the side and another ball sets right up. You can also pause and take a look at your swing analysis. My husband always asks me what's wrong with his swing so this was perfect. You're able to see where the ball made contact, face angle, back spin, and all the analysis you can request for to make your next swing better. They offer custom club fitting and classes. If we didn't live so far away, this would be a good option to improve our game. Plenty of parking since it's inside the shopping center where HMart is at. Go up the escalator and you'll see it in the corner. Easy to find. Easy to park. No hassle experience. Great place to would come again if in the area.
